A red laser pointer with a wavelength of 635 nm is shined on a double slit producing a diffraction pattern on a screen that is 1.75 m behind the double slit. The central maximum of the diffraction pattern has a width of 4.30 cm, and the fourth bright spot is missing on both sides. What is the size of the individual slits?
